Enhancing Campus Security: The Role of AI-Powered Zero-Trust Networking in Higher Education

Colleges and universities are reevaluating their approach to network security, placing AI-enabled segmentation at the forefront of this transformation. In today’s digital landscape, ensuring a robust security framework is more critical than ever, especially within the highly interconnected environments of educational institutions. As these campuses operate like small cities, the imperative for a secure yet accessible network becomes increasingly vital.

The Imperative of Connectivity in Higher Education

Connectivity is the backbone of higher education, intertwining learning, research, and campus operations with seamless internet access. This intricate web of digital necessities poses significant security challenges. Jon Young, director of strategy and innovation for higher education at Extreme Networks, aptly states, “Colleges and universities are essentially mini cities, and a secure network is essential to success in that environment.”

Navigating the Challenges of Zero Trust

Implementing a zero trust approach within higher education can be fraught with challenges. However, modernizing network architecture with AI capabilities offers promising solutions. Institutions can provide secure connections for students, faculty, and staff while preserving the openness that is central to campus culture.

  • AI-Enabled Segmentation: By leveraging AI, schools can effectively manage and monitor network traffic, ensuring that potential threats are identified and mitigated promptly.
  • Enhanced User Experience: A robust security architecture promotes a secure environment without compromising user accessibility.
